    Welcome tmg.

    You found probably the best place in the UK to buy a razor ( the invisible edge )
    Could also try Strop-Shop.Co.UK < best place for strops in the UK too.
    There is a UK based forum called The Shaving Room and you should be able to pick up a good vintage blade at a good price from there if you ask !
    Personally I prefer a hanging strop but a paddle may be easier for a beginner.

    Best of luck, you have a great journey ahead of you !
